Electroencephalogram (EEG) Technicians use specialized equipment and processes to monitor a patient’s nervous system activity. They set up, perform and monitor EEG tests which record the electrical activity of a patient’s brain over time. A caregiver who excels in this role will:  

  • Perform routine and complex EEG examinations in the laboratory, at the patients bedside, Intensive Care Units and operating room. 

  • Select predetermined electrode combinations and observe patient with video recording equipment. 

  • Ensure EEG and tape are lined up exactly. 

  • Check focus, lighting and microphone. 

  • Abstract relevant information from the patients clinical record and obtain additional information. 

  • Perform electroencephalographic examinations on patients. 

  • Schedule and organize special procedure tests, angiography, X-ray studies, etc. 

  • Serve as an instructor for new personnel. 

  • Provide training in the interpretation of EEG recordings, applications and the academics of EEG technology. 

  • Maintain equipment in clean operating condition and perform proper maintenance. 

Minimum qualifications for the ideal future caregiver include:  

  • Completion of an accredited EEG program OR an Associate's Degree in Electroneurodiagnostics or related patient care field 

  • Registered EEG Technician (R.EEG.T) 

  • Basic Life Support (BLS) certification through the American Heart Association (AHA) or the American Red Cross 

  • One year experience as an EEG Technician 

Physical Requirements:

  • Manual dexterity in order to place electrodes precisely and to operate recording equipment.

  • Ability to push and maneuver EEG machine weighing 320 pounds and Evoked Potential machine weighing 420 pounds.

  • Requires corrected hearing and vision to normal range.

  • Requires some exposure to communicable disease or body fluids.

Personal Protective Equipment:

  • Follows standard precautions using personal protective equipment as required.
